Roman House Part II - The Drawing


Step 58

Color the tile area with color #B12C00, using a hard-edged opaque brush.

clip_image120


Step 59

Add shadows around the tiles with color #611700 with a soft-edged brush set to 41% opacity.

clip_image122


Step 60

On a new layer above the last (this will be merged down), add a highlight to the center of each of the tiles with color #F0681D (use a 105 pixel brush set to 18% opacity).

clip_image124


Step 61

Use the burn tool set to midtones mode and 46% exposure to add shadows to the floor. Make sure that the darkest shadows are cast by the columns and the potted plant.
